Perhaps the world's most distinct-looking and recognisable breed, the Dalmatian is prized for much more than his spots. From coach dog to firehouse mascot to movie star, the dynamic Dalmatian does it all! He is a high-energy playmate, an intuitive friend and everything in between to his owners; it is hard to find a more versatile dog. This book provides the much-needed factual information about the Dalmatian and its ancestry, character and standard, as well as the proper selection, feeding, training, preventative healthcare and behaviour of the breed. The new owner will welcome advice about puppy-proofing the home, preparing for the pup's arrival and preventing puppy problems. In addition to an extremely authoritative text, this book presents over 135 photographs in full colour, which prove to be as informative as they are attractive. Helpful hints and important information are highlighted to provide easy access to everything the reader needs to know about life with a Dalmatian. Whether it's dietary concerns, allergies or fleas, this book is the way to prevention, providing the reader with the necessary guidance an owner needs from puppyhood through the senior years. Recommended by top breeders and trainers, this book is the responsible first choice of every new owner of a Dalmatian. Topics discussed include history of the Dalmatian, characteristics of the Dalmatian, the Dalmatian Breed Standard, your puppy Dalmatian, everyday care of your Dalmatian, housebreaking and training, healthcare, when your Dalmatian gets old and showing your Dalmatian.
